“Classic local *meat-and-three* southern diner. Had a lunch there today with my mom. Food is very good, especially the vegetables! (Butter beans, field peas, and fried okra were all yum.) Great service, friendly folks. (They even went to a bit of extra trouble so we could have hot tea.) Lots of tables to accommodate families and groups. It is is one big room filled with tables and chairs, so I can't really say anything about "atmosphere." But I do recommend it, and we'll be back!Vegetarian options: They offer multiple vegetables each day. I do not know if they offer vegan though.Parking: The restaurant is a large building with its own large parking lot.Kid-friendliness: Very family-friendly.“
